โ† Back to home

Swipa.meme

Memecoin collecting with Tinder UI and points. If you like it, swipe right ๐Ÿš€

Screenshots

Swipa.meme screenshot 1
Swipa.meme screenshot 2
Swipa.meme screenshot 3
Swipa.meme screenshot 4
Swipa.meme screenshot 5
Swipa.meme screenshot 6

Problem Statement

We're bringing memecoins to the masses, using a familiar touch: the swipe โœ”๏ธMemecoins are eating the world. In 2024, the memecoin market cap is $44.9B, and it's only going to grow. We want everyone in the world to join in on the fun.Introducing: Swipa.memeHow does it work?Swipe right to pump it.Swipe left to dunk it.Earn points. Have fun!

Solution

The project is a PWA that aims to abstract as much of the boring and difficult web3 elements of crypto away from users so that they can focus on the fun of curating and rating memes for points.One point = one swipe = $0.01Tech stackNext.js React Web AppVercel DeploymentViem, Wagmi for onchain hooksAlchemy AccountKit v4 for user account management and gas sponsorshipRainbowkit for optional crypto top-ups0x APIs for swapping eth for memecoinsBase Mainnet memecoin liquidity poolsUser OnboardingAlchemy AccountKit v4 for simple onboarding and wallet creationAlchemy Gas Manager to sponsor gas on behalf of users to minimize frictionRainbowkit to make crypto deposits easier for getting startedSwipingWhen a user swipes, we use 0x APIs to find the most optimal trade route for Base ETH to the memecoin token, and then take that route data, package it into calldata wrapped as a user op that's sent to the Alchemy bundler, paid for via the Swipa.meme gas manager.The resulting token value is displayed to users as "points".Cashing outWhen a user wants to cash out their points, we use 0x APIs to construct the opposite trade route from the memecoin back into Base ETH. Any amount of liquid Base ETH in the user's wallet is displayed to users as "swipes".

Hackathon

ETHGlobal San Francisco

2024

Contributors